James River West of Nixa at State Highway 14 (11NPSWRD_WQX-WICR_CCHD_JRWN) site data in the Water Quality Portal

Data Provider: STORET (Learn more about Water Quality Portal Data Providers)

This river/stream site, maintained by the National Park Service Water Resources Division (identifier 11NPSWRD_WQX), has the name "James River West of Nixa at State Highway 14" and has the identifier 11NPSWRD_WQX-WICR_CCHD_JRWN. This site is in the watershed defined by the 8 digit Hydrologic Unit Code (HUC)11010002.

This site is located in Christian County County, Missouri at 37.0454000000 degrees latitude and -93.3900000000 degrees longitude using the datum NAD27. No horizontal location accuracy metadata is available.
